PENS WIN!!!!!!!!!!! Take 3 Games to None Lead over Columbus

The Pittsburgh Penguins over came another slow start on Sunday Night In Game 3 of Round 1 of the 2017 Stanley Cup Playoffs beating the Columbus Blue Jackets 5 to 4 in over time. The Pens now have a commanding three games to none lead in the series. Cam Atkinson scored for Columbus just 11 seconds into the game.  Jake Guentzel then tied the game up at the 3:17 mark of the first period. At the 5:02 mark of the first period Cam Atkinson scored again and then just 68 seconds later Zach Werenski scored giving the Blue Jackets a 3 to 1 lead after one period. Bryan Rust scored at the 5:21 and 13:25 mark of the second period tying the game going into the third period.  Jake Guentzel then scored his second of the game at the 13:10 mark of the third period giving the pens a 5 to 4 lead. Brandon Dubinsky  then scored late at the 15:11 mark tying the game back up. The overtime period was exciting and quick paced through out with both teams getting many opportunities to score. In the end Jake Guentzel snuck the puck under the pads of Sergei Bobrovsky at the 13:10 mark of the first overtime to give the Pens the victory and a commanding three games to none lead on the series over the Blue Jackets.  Marc Andre Fleury was again stellar and kept the Pens in the game throughout. The Pens can wrap up the series in game four on Tuesday night from Columbus. Air-time on Beaver County Radio 1230 WBVP and 1460 WMBA is 7 pm with puck drop at 7:30 pm. Guentzels hat trick and game winner in over time is the first time since the 1940’s that a rookie has done that.
